306. anaballó

to put off
Original Word: ἀναβάλλομαι
Transliteration: anaballó
Phonetic Spelling: (an-ab-al'-lom-ahee)
Short Definition: defer
Word Origin
from ana and balló
Definition
to put off
NASB Word Usage
put...off (1).

defer.

Middle voice from ana and ballo; to put off (for oneself) -- defer.
